Hyderabad: 60 lakh worth gold seized at RGI airport

HYDERABAD: On Wednesday, the Directorate of Revenue Intelligence (DRI) officials have seized gold worth Rs 60 lakh.

According to the report published in The Hans India, the DRI sleuths seized the gold which was hidden under a seat in Air India flight which is learned to have arrived in Shamshabad from Dubai on Wednesday morning.

The officials suspected that the passenger feared of getting caught at the airport and so he concealed the gold under the seat.

The gold was found under the seat number 27. The passenger is yet to be identified.
